Take responsibility for your game!

Below are common reasons why junior tennis players do not reach their stated goals. Taking personal responsibility is paramount to the process of becoming a good player. 

Players often have not learned to push themselves physically in practice, not patient, not focused, too social (this one is common), having unrealistic goals, having no goals, poor footwork habits, lack of motivation, only want to have fun, poor concentration, lack of time management and organization, unable to control emotions, lack of competitiveness, fear of failure, too much doubt and indecisiveness, lack of commitment, lack of routine and unrealistic goals. Also, player perspectives on winning are often not realistic or helpful to the process and losing is not dealt with correctly.

Also, parents need to stop "helicopter parenting". It is detrimental to the developmental process. Kids are resilient and hard wired to deal with problems.  Let them learn and grow without too much interference! 😀
